It's called Therapets. A non-profit Fishsrs based group headed by Darlene Gosnell. This former teacher suffered a horrific car accident 10 years ago...she knew her dogs helped her heal. Why couldn't dogs help other people get well faster...or give comfort to those in pain? Armed with only her instincts and 'dogged' determination...in 2004 she started Therapets. Now Darlene's mission is so successful, she's on call 24/7 at St Vincent Hospital. She trains her little Westies and Cairn terriers to comfort the sick ( she even visits hospice patients and tramua cases). We'll tag along on her route ...specifically with children this day. We'll visit a little girl who has CP and had her legs operated on...she pets and talks to one of the white Westies put on her bed. A small boy who had a heart operation won't talk to anyone but reaches out to rub the little fuzzy dog on his small cart. And hear from the medical staff who endorse this outreach program, and find comfort themselves in the TheraPet visits.

Amazing dogs, and an amazing story...kleenex please...

Meet Betty Jordon, a former vet tech and K-9 Search and Rescue lady who lost both
her legs when her motorcycle and a semi tangled a few years ago. Her dogs have been her salvation, giving her love but .. she can't train bloodhounds anymore, can't do the job she loved..she is looking for an ATV donation to help her work with search dogs again...Maybe you know of someone who can help her, after viewing her story?
